Product

Problem

Current drug development and testing for neurological disorders often relies on animal models or 2D cell cultures, which fail to accurately replicate the complexity of the human brain, leading to ineffective treatments and high failure rates in clinical trials. Existing methods for studying neurological diseases lack fully ethical, humane, and scalable solutions for pharmaceutical companies to perform neuro-clinical testing.

Solution

CanniOasis offers a human midbrain organoid platform for accelerating the development of precision cannabinoid-based drugs for neurological disorders. The platform utilizes 3D brain cell structures derived from induced pluripotent stem cells (iPSCs) to mimic the natural environment of the human brain, enabling more accurate study of cellular behaviors and interactions. This approach allows for proprietary drug screening, validation technologies, and drug development strategies, supported by MicroRNA (MiRNA) and epigenetics, to develop proprietary drug screening platforms for cannabinoid-based treatments of neurological diseases, supported by Artificial Intelligence. The company leverages advanced drug delivery formulations to maximize drug effectiveness by targeting specific tissues with precision.

Target Audience

The primary target audience includes pharmaceutical companies, research institutions, and healthcare organizations involved in drug discovery and development for neurological disorders such as Autism, Chronic Pain, Parkinson’s disease, and Epilepsy.
